Transaction 341666af74f336c62eb7db341c75d3e981254ec46bfb7632b6255f38d13b223d

2 Input
2 Outputs
  • 341666af74f336c62eb7db341c75d3e981254ec46bfb7632b6255f38d13b223d:0
  • value  1007659
    address  2Myx8D2yPLq7prBEb8yf6QnqvGmpCKCHPqn
  • 341666af74f336c62eb7db341c75d3e981254ec46bfb7632b6255f38d13b223d:1
  • value  68153
    address  2N3WmZ133zmBZf32VY8v7ZpdxioBcy7uwH8